Momoa vs. Till in Hayter’s werewolf movie Wolves

David Hayter’s on-again off-again on-again werewolf movie “Wolves” has attracted actors Jason Momoa (“Conan the Barbarian”) and Lucas Till (“X-Men : First Class”), according to THR.

Hayter wrote the script for Wolves, which centers on a young man (Lucas Till) who transforms into a werewolf and finds himself on the run after the murder of his parent. He eventually arriving at a small town called Lupine Ridge that has a history of supernatural happenings.

Momoa, who plays the bad guy in the new Sylvester Stallone vehicle “Bullet to the Head”, plays the “bad ass” in this again.

The Toronto-filmed movie is “X-Men” scribe Hayter’s first directing venture.
